ALTHOUGH IT was a very wet week leading up to the day of Yarrow Show, the ground remained in relatively good condition, while the day itself managed to stay dry and rather pleasant.

The show committee welcomed a good number of entries in the sheep lines, with the biggest section coming from the Blackfaces.

However, on this occasion, bigger did not mean better, and it was the Bluefaced Leicester which took the interbreed sheep championship. 

This came from Alan McClymont, of Kirkstead, Yarrow.

Coming in reserve was Alan Cowens, of Philiphaugh Farms.
